About this listen

In a hilarious short story from New York Times bestselling author Fredrik Backman, the absurdities of modern life cause one man’s solitary world to spin suddenly, and comically, out of control.

Lucas knows the perfect night entails just three things: video games, wine, and pad thai. Peanuts are a must! Other people? Not so much. Why complicate things when he’s happy alone?

Then one day the apartment board, a vexing trio of authority, rings his doorbell. And Lucas’s solitude takes a startling hike. They demand to see his frying pan. Someone left one next to the recycling room overnight, and instead of removing the errant object, as Lucas suggests, they insist on finding the guilty party. But their plan backfires. Colossally.

Told in Fredrik Backman’s singular witty style with sharply drawn characters and relatable antics, The Answer Is No is a laugh-out-loud portrait of a man struggling to keep to himself in a world that won’t leave him alone.

Someone is probably going to be murdered

Fredrik Backman's "The Answer is No" is a short story that delves into the complexities of human connection and the desire for solitude in a bustling world. The protagonist, Lucas, is a man who cherishes his quiet existence, but his peace is shattered when a misplaced frying pan leads to a series of unexpected encounters with his nosy neighbors.

Backman's writing is witty and insightful, effortlessly capturing the absurdities of everyday life and the nuances of human behavior. The characters are endearingly flawed and relatable, each grappling with their own insecurities and longing for connection. The story explores themes of loneliness, community, and the importance of finding balance between our individual needs and our social responsibilities.

Overall, "The Answer is No" is a thought-provoking and entertaining read that resonates with anyone who has ever felt the urge to escape the chaos of the world and retreat into their own private sanctuary. Backman's ability to blend humor with poignant observations of human nature makes this a truly captivating tale.

Nice!

I enjoyed this short story way more than I expected.
The humor is great, and the story is really heartwarming. It doesn't need much to get us to understand the characters, and it doesn't feel rushed.

At some point, we've all probably been or wanted to be like Lucas—just minding our own business. We usually don't realize how our boundaries or lack thereof, can hurt or block the people who care about us, or invite inconveniences. It's all about finding that balance, plus a little reflection and self-love. Living is hard enough.

That's my take on the story. I totally recommend it, and the audiobook is awesome.
